秦山核电三期工程取水口冲淤变化研究和预测

摘    要:本文采用河床演变分析的方法研究秦山核电三期工程取水口附近海床的冲淤变化 ,并用数学模型和实体模型在验证的基础上进行了近期变化预测 ,为核电厂安全运行数十年和保证循环冷却水正常供水提供了科学依据。

关 键 词:河床演变  数学模型  实体模型  预测

Prediction about Seabed Erosion/Siltation near the Water Intake of Third phase Project for Qinshan Nuclear Power Plant

Abstract:Based on the analysis of fluvial processes,seabed erosion/-siltation near the water intake of the Third phase Project of Qinshan Nuclear Power Plant was studied. With mathematical and physical modeling,possible variation of the nearby seabed in the near future was predicted. It provides a scientific reference for the plant to operate safely for a long time and to ensure continuous intake of cooling water.
Keywords:fluvial process  mathematical simulation  physical model  predictio
